What is nudeus?

It appears that "nudeus" may be a misspelling or a mispronunciation of the word "nucleus," which refers to the central core of an atom or a cell that contains genetic material.


Sub atomic parts inside and outside the nudeus of your atom?

I am assuming your question is: "what are the sub atomic molecules inside and outside the nucleus of an atom?" Here is the answer: There are three subatomic particles, Protons Neutrons and Electrons. Protons are located inside the nucleus of an atom, along with Neutrons. Electrons are located outside the nucleus, inside things called energy levels, but i won't go into to much detail.
